rpcrt4: Set the socket back to blocking in rpcrt4_conn_tcp_handoff as
the read and write function for the protseq assume that syscalls will block.

---

 dlls/rpcrt4/rpc_transport.c |    2 ++
 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/dlls/rpcrt4/rpc_transport.c b/dlls/rpcrt4/rpc_transport.c
index d50b60b..a90b73c 100644
--- a/dlls/rpcrt4/rpc_transport.c
+++ b/dlls/rpcrt4/rpc_transport.c
@@ -684,6 +684,8 @@ static RPC_STATUS rpcrt4_conn_tcp_handof
     ERR("Failed to accept a TCP connection: error %d\n", ret);
     return RPC_S_SERVER_UNAVAILABLE;
   }
+  /* reset to blocking behaviour */
+  fcntl(ret, F_SETFL, 0);
   client->sock = ret;
   TRACE("Accepted a new TCP connection\n");
   return RPC_S_OK;
